Pulaski County Assessors determine the value of properties and parcels in order to assess property taxes in Pulaski County, AR. The Assessor's Office maintains current data on every parcel in the district, which includes Pulaski County GIS maps, tax maps, and property maps. These maps show property lines, structures, addresses, and the value of properties in the Assessor's jurisdiction. Tax Assessor's Offices provide online access to property maps.

Pulaski County Building Departments develop and enforce building codes to ensure the construction of safe buildings in Pulaski County, AR. The Building Department maintains records on design plans for construction and renovation projects, which can include Pulaski County GIS maps and zoning maps. These maps show property lines, current structures on the parcel, and modifications to any structures, including new buildings. Many Building Depts provide online databases to access GIS databases, maps and related property information.

Pulaski County Clerks file documents and preserve municipal records in order to maintain an archive in Pulaski County, AR. The Clerk's Office contains a number of documents on property, including GIS maps and property maps that show property lines, registered lands, and, in some cases, property tax assessments. Pulaski County GIS maps may also include information on soil composition, floodplains, air traffic, and more. Many County Clerk Offices provide online databases to access GIS and property maps.

Pulaski County Recorders of Deeds collect public records, primarily documents related to property, and make them available to the public in Pulaski County, AR. The Deeds Registrar maintains records on land transactions within its jurisdiction, including Pulaski County GIS and property maps. These maps show property lines, Pulaski County property and parcel surveys, and, in some cases, property transactions and tax liens. Many Recorders of Deeds provide online databases to access free GIS maps, as well as related property information.
